: The game executable ( .exe ) is calling for a specific 16-channel audio mixing instruction, but the local binkw32.dll file found in the game folder is an older version that does not support it.
The text string you searched for, binksetmixbins16dll , is a misspelled blend of the function name BinkSetMixBins and the number 16 from the error, combined with the file extension .dll . The actual file at the heart of this issue is .
